What Are French Doors?

French doors typically include 2 hinged doors that open outward or inward, typically featuring glass panels from top to bottom. They are a flexible choice, commonly used to link living areas to patio areas, gardens, decks, or balconies. Their attractive design not just improves aesthetic appeal but also enables greater light circulation, making areas feel larger and more welcoming.

Kinds Of Glass Used in French Doors

When considering French door glass, it's important to know the various types offered. Each type provides different benefits in terms of looks, insulation, and privacy. Here is a table outlining the most common kinds of glass used in French doors:

Type of GlassDescriptionBenefits
Clear GlassStandard glass that provides unobstructed views.Maximum visibility and light.
Frosted GlassGlass treated to diffuse light and obscure presence.Improved personal privacy without compromising light.
Tempered GlassShatterproof glass that is heat-treated to increase strength.Shatter-resistant; more secure for homes.
Low-E GlassGlass with an unique coating that shows infrared light while permitting noticeable light in.Enhanced energy performance; UV defense.
Laminated GlassTwo layers of glass bonded together with a plastic interlayer.Sound insulation; shatter-resistant.
Odd GlassGlass that is dealt with to have a textured surface area, obscuring views.Suitable for bathrooms and personal areas.

Aspects to Consider When Choosing French Door Glass

Picking the best French door glass includes considering different factors:

1. Area and Usage

  • Determine where the doors will be installed and how frequently they will be used. For example, doors leading to a high-traffic patio might require more durable glass options.

2. Aesthetic Preferences

  • Select a glass type based upon your individual style. Clear glass offers a modern-day appearance, while frosted or odd glass can use more privacy.

3. Energy Efficiency

  • Select Low-E glass or insulated glass systems to improve energy efficiency and lower heating and cooling costs.

4. Security and Security

  • Think about tempered or laminated glass for doors leading to the outside for added security.

5. Maintenance

  • Consider how much time you're prepared to buy cleaning and keeping the glass. Particular glass types may need more frequent upkeep.

Installation Tips for French Door Glass

Installing French doors is a task that often requires professional proficiency. Here are crucial tips to think about during installation:

  • Hire a Professional: To make sure a proper fit and avoid complications, employing a certified specialist who focuses on door installations is recommended.
  • Frame the Doors Correctly: Ensure that the door frame is square and level to avoid future issues with door positioning or operation.
  • Usage Quality Hardware: Invest in top quality hinges, handles, and locks for durability and security.
  • Look For Weather Stripping: Proper sealing between the door and frame will improve energy performance and avoid drafts.
